20% of men and 4% of women know team-mates struggling with drug misuse
A recent survey of more than 3,600 inter-county players by the Gaelic Players Association found that 20% of men and 4% of women knew team-mates struggling with drug misuse.
On a broader societal level, drug addiction is now a problem in every town and village countrywide.
Cuan Mhuire Addiction Treatment Centre in Athy currently has a waiting list of 109 men and 60 women seeking treatment for drug addiction, mainly cocaine addiction.
The same treatment centre had just nine people on a waiting list ten years ago.
